We compared two Mobile platform GPUs: 6GB VRAM GeForce RTX 3050 Mobile Refresh 6 GB and 6GB VRAM GeForce RTX 2060 Max Q Refresh to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A GeForce RTX 3050 Mobile Refresh 6 GB 's Advantages
Released 3 years and 6 months late
Boost Clock has increased by 24% (1492MHz vs 1200MHz)
640 additional rendering cores
Lower TDP (75W vs 115W)
NVIDIA GeForce RTX 2060 Max Q Refresh 's Advantages
Larger VRAM bandwidth (259.8GB/s vs 168.0GB/s)
